When (NYSE: BRK-A)(NYSE: BRK-B) launched its third-quarter revenues report, we discovered that Warren Buffett and his group had quite an active quarter in the stock exchange. The cost basis of Berkshire's enormous stock portfolio increased by about $9. 6 billion, and it appeared that there had been some selling in the portfolio too.

Here's a breakdown of the current moves financiers ought to understand about. Image source: The Motley Fool. We currently knew about a couple stock purchases Buffett and his lieutenants made-- particularly that they spent more than $2 billion including to their currently big position in and invested $720 million in's current IPO.

Market value since 11/16/2020. The greatest story on the purchasing side was the addition of not one however 4 big pharma stocks. Buffett (or among his stock pickers) started stakes worth nearly $6 billion entirely, consisting of 3 large and almost equal-sized positions in AbbVie, Merck, and Bristol Myers.

The stock market came roaring back during the third quarter, and Warren Buffett busied himself by adding and selling a variety of stakes in (BRK.B) portfolio. The most noteworthy theme of the 3 months ended Sept. 30 was the continuing legend of Berkshire's diminishing bank stocks. Buffett has been cutting the holding company's position in banks for multiple quarters, however he truly doubled down in Q3.

Most intriguing, as constantly, is what Warren Buffett was buying. With the COVID-19 pandemic gripping the world, maybe it shouldn't come as a surprise that Berkshire Hathaway added a handful of pharmaceutical stocks to its portfolio. Buffett likewise picked up a telecom business and an unusual initial public offering (IPO).

Securities and Exchange Commission needs all financial investment supervisors with more than $100 million in possessions to submit a Kind 13F quarterly to divulge any changes in share ownership. These filings add an essential level of transparency to the stock exchange and provide Buffett-ologists an opportunity to get a bead on what he's believing.

However if he pares his holdings in a stock, it can spark investors to rethink their own financial investments. And keep in mind: Not all "Warren Buffett stocks" are in fact his picks. Axalta, that makes industrial finishings and paints for building exteriors, pipelines and vehicles, signed up with the ranks of the Buffett stocks in 2015, when Berkshire Hathaway purchased 20 million shares in AXTA from personal equity company Carlyle Group (CG) - warren buffett omaha. The stake makes good sense offered that Buffett is a veteran fan of the paint market; Berkshire Hathaway bought house-paint maker Benjamin Moore in 2000.



The company, that makes commercial finishings and paints for constructing exteriors, pipelines and cars and trucks, is the belle of the ball when it pertains to mergers and acquisitions suitors. The business has rejected more than one buyout quote in the past, and experts note that it's a perfect target for numerous international coverings companies.
